According to Roger, you are continually influencing other people whether you are aware of it or not. And would it not be useful to work on having these influence situations turn out better for both of you? One error that people often make, including some seasoned sales professionals, is to present their idea or product in a way that makes sense to themselves; that is how they like to buy into an idea. But we are all different and have different “buying strategies”. You need to present your suggestion in the way that the other person can see the benefits they will gain and in the way they like to process information and to buy.
